Imran Khan Filed PIL in Bombay High Court


Bollywood’s rising star Imran Khan filed a PIL in the Bombay High Court challenging Maharashtra government's decision of raising the legal age limit for consuming alcohol from 21 to 25 years.

The Jaane Tu Ya Jaane Na and Delhi Belly fame actor said the state government's action violated the fundamental rights of a citizen living in a democratic country.

Superstar Aamir Khan’s nephew Imran Khan expressed his deep disappointment on the general view of looking at youth as irresponsible in the country.




Imran told "By this PIL I am not promoting drinking but fighting for the constitutional right of the youth in India. When a 21-year-old is allowed to marry, vote and do several other things, then he or she should also be allowed to indulge in any legal activity including consumption of liquor."

"If the government has not banned sale of liquor then anyone above the age of 21 should have the choice of consuming it. A major can decide for himself what is right and wrong," the 28-year-old actor adds.
